Method

Preparation of Seafood

  1. 1

    Shucking Oysters

    Carefully shuck the blue point oysters using an oyster knife. Set aside on a plate with ice.

  2. 2

    Preparing Scallops

    Pat the diver scallops dry with a paper towel. Cut each scallop in half horizontally for quicker marination.

  3. 3

    Preparing Snapper

    Cut the scarlet snapper fillet into small cubes, about 1 cm in size. Place in a bowl.

Making the Marinade

  1. 4

    Mixing Marinade

    In a separate bowl, combine fresh lime juice, fresh lemon juice, salt, and black pepper. Mix well until salt is dissolved.

Marinating Seafood

  1. 5

    Marinating Scallops and Snapper

    Pour the marinade over the cubed scarlet snapper and halved diver scallops. Stir gently to coat. Cover and refrigerate for 30 minutes.

Assembling the Ceviche Sampler

  1. 6

    Preparing Vegetables

    Thinly slice the red onion, jalapeño pepper, and radishes. Dice the avocado. Place all prepared vegetables in a bowl.

  2. 7

    Combining Ingredients

    After 30 minutes, remove the marinated scallops and snapper from the fridge. Add the marinated seafood to the bowl with the vegetables and mix gently.

  3. 8

    Serving

    To serve, place the shucked oysters on a serving platter. Spoon the ceviche mixture over the oysters. Garnish with chopped cilantro and additional jalapeño slices if desired.
